Key Features

LlamaIndex

  • Document parsing - Extract structured data from unstructured documents.
  • Data indexing - Create searchable indexes for efficient data retrieval.
  • Extraction tools - Pull specific information from various data sources.
  • Workflow automation - Streamline processes across different industries.
  • Integration support - Connect with external data sources and APIs.

Microsoft Designer

  • AI-driven design suggestions for layouts and graphics.
  • Customizable templates for various design needs.
  • Drag-and-drop interface for easy editing.
  • Integration with Microsoft 365 for seamless workflow.
  • Export options for social media, print, and web formats.

LlamaIndex Pros

  • + High accuracy in document parsing and extraction, supporting complex layouts and handwritten notes.
  • + Seamless integration with existing tech stacks through pre-built connectors.
  • + Comprehensive modular components for rapid development and deployment of AI applications.
  • + Event-driven workflow engine allowing precise control over document processing pipelines.
  • + Strong focus on security and compliance, with certifications like SOC 2 Type II, GDPR, and HIPAA.
  • + Flexible pricing tiers catering to different user needs, from free to enterprise-level solutions.

LlamaIndex Cons

  • Initial setup and configuration may require technical expertise.
  • Higher credit costs for advanced parsing and extraction features.
  • Limited support for non-Python environments.
  • Some users may find the credit-based pricing model complex.
  • Customization options may be overwhelming for small teams with limited resources.

Microsoft Designer Pros

  • + AI-driven design suggestions enhance creativity and efficiency.
  • + Extensive template library saves time and inspires new ideas.
  • + User-friendly interface makes design accessible to non-experts.
  • + Seamless integration with Microsoft 365 improves productivity.
  • + Collaboration tools support teamwork and remote work.
  • + Customizable branding kits ensure brand consistency.

Microsoft Designer Cons

  • Limited offline functionality may hinder use in areas with poor internet connectivity.
  • Some advanced features may require a learning curve for new users.
  • Free tier has limited access to premium templates and features.
  • Integration with non-Microsoft tools can be limited.
  • Customization options, while extensive, may not meet every niche need.
